Progress Report for April – June 2015.
Multipronged approaches to bring youth into agriculture.
21% of the agricultural lands have been sold in the past 3 years for non-agricultural purposes in Trichy District. Same trend has been in many parts of State of Tamil Nadu, India. Increase in expenses and decreases in yield and loss in economy are some reasons. Now, lack of manpower is another reason. There are no farmers to operate machines.
For the past 15 years, VOICE Trust is doing agriculture in 18 acres of land under rainfed cultivation system with the help of 9 models of organic manuring and bio pest repellants (See photo of Azolla algae). Azolla can be easily grown by youth in their house surroundings and sold to farmers for nutrient value to the crops (also to control growing of weeds), as fodder for cattle and as nutrient diet for children. For every one rupee invested, Indian rupees 2.16 has been earned after deduction of all expenses including wages for farmers which usually they do not include. Now, 320 tons of vegetables per month are being brought under equitable marketing to give better margin to farmers without any middlemen misappropriation.
On April 1, 2015, Project Director of VOICE Trust addressed 359 teachers from rural schools to encourage youth to join agriculture. Special trainings offered for specific works like gathering of seeds and conducting of seed efficiency tests, preparation of organic manures and bio pest repellants and value addition to agriculture produce.
